Output 54c2cd9493bc4962fcba9d17b45d212c4990543e69a253f98fe15e86e6887532:25

value
133106
script pubkey
OP_0 OP_PUSHBYTES_20 3b580fc0bc3163e20d0d70a5931e9e82f811a8b3
address
bc1q8dvqls9ux937yrgdwzjex857stupr29na379dn
transaction
54c2cd9493bc4962fcba9d17b45d212c4990543e69a253f98fe15e86e6887532